MONGEZ, Antoine (1747-1835) - Tableaux, Statutes, Bas-Reliefs et Camées, de la Galerie de Florence et du Palais Pitti. Paris: Lacombe, 1789 [mancano i volumi III e IV pubblicati fino al 1807?].   First two volumes, containing most of the plates, of the impressive illustrated history of the treasures of the Florence Gallery Pitti. The oeuvre includes several paintings and sculptures by European masters and artifacts from classical antiquity.   2 volumes only (of 4), elephant folio (561 x 385mm). Engraved coat of arms of the dedicatee, Emperor Leopold II, on title, 153 (of 200) engraved plates protected by tissue paper (lacking title, some restored tears, sometimes large, and reinforcements including on title, foxing). Contemporary red half leather over decorated paper plates, title on spine (rubbed, scuffed and somewhat worn). Provenance: G. Botta (bookplate on titles and stamps).
